Five injured in Russian attacks on Kherson Oblast

Five people were injured in Kherson Oblast due to Russian strikes and drone attacks on 22 June.
Source: Kherson Oblast Prosecutor's Office
Details: Investigators have found that Russian forces used tubed artillery and drones of various types to strike settlements in the region throughout the day.
As of 17:30, five people are known to have been injured, including four in Kherson and one man in the village of Molodetske. All were injured as a result of Russian drone attacks.
Among those injured is an official from Kherson Oblast Military Administration.
The Russian strikes also damaged houses, apartment blocks, an office building, a cultural institution, a kindergarten, a warehouse, a lorry and cars.
A pre-trial investigation has been launched into these war crimes under Article 438.1 of the Criminal Code of Ukraine.
